I have just received my THQ, but when I attach it to the NXT and run VKB Device Config tool it appears not to detect the THQ. Should the blue title bar of the tool list both the NXT & THQ?
I have unplugged & reattched the cable connecting each many times, but nothing changes. When looking at the external devices, I only see this
Has anyone come across this before? Any ideas on what else I can try?

richard.hewett wrote:Has anyone come across this before? Any ideas on what else I can try?
Press the large square Default button, then, after the joystick restarts, click yes if asked to autoconfigure it. If the autoconfigure box doesn't pop up navigate to Global/External and press the Find&AutoConfig button, then calibrate.
If it still doesn't work let me know and I'll guide you through reflashing to the latest firmware.
Leifr wrote:doesn't work in the software at all
Make sure you plug the 3 pins cable into the 4 pins socket like in the pic below; have your devices disconnected from USB while doing this.
Then plug back to USB and do the same as above.
